— Selecting the collaborators —

 

Double Exposures aspires to include a wide range of artists across generations and practices and the final selection of collaborators comes from a great pool of suggestions made by different voices, hopefully reflecting the vibrant environment of artists working with performance across a wide range of approaches in the UK.

— ‘Reversing the Gaze’ —

 

In dialogue with the Live Art Development Agency an initial selection was made of artists who collaborated with Manuel Vason on Exposures in 2002. At a second stage a further selection was made of artists who have worked with Manuel Vason at some other point in his career. In addition to this, the twenty-two organisational members of Live Art UK were invited to each recommend two artists based anywhere in the UK, whose work has most caught their eye over the last ten years.

— ‘Double Image’—

 

The ‘Double Image’ artists in Double Exposures are collaborating with Manuel for the first time. They are being selected by Manuel following recommendations from UK based artists and promoters. The ‘Reversing the Gaze’ artists, who have previously collaborated with Manuel on Exposures, were each invited to propose five artists from a younger generation who had caught their attention over the last few years. Additionally, members of Live Art UK were each invited to recommend up to three artists who they felt were amongst the most significant to have emerged over the last decade.

 

The final selection has nearly been finalised and is comprised of practitioners from across generations, who had not collaborated with Manuel in the past and whose work centres on the body as the site and subject of their practice.
